At today's special event the first product Apple introduced was the new Intel Mac Mini. The low end Mac mini system will be available today and has a 1.5GHz Core Solo system with 667MHz bus, 512MB RAM, 60GB SATA hard drive and "Combo" DVD-ROM/CD-RW drive for $599.

Showtime has joined iTunes today. Three shows (Weeds, Sleeper Cell, and Fat Actress) are now available on the iTunes music store. NBC has started selling the show The Biggest Loser on iTunes as well. This all coincides with the Billion Song Contest.
